Curso A medida
Duración:
90 horas
Para qué te prepara:
Creación de Webs dinámicas, mediante la programación de distintos lenguajes. Gestión de bases de datos a través de internet mediante el diseño de páginas webs.
A continuación tengo el placer de presentarles los nuevos cursos, como siempre a la vanguardia de la formación profesional en informática. Estamos seguros que encontrará en ellos la respuesta profesio...
contactar con el responsable| Requisitos |
Residentes en España
|
| Precio |
Consultar con el centro de formación |
PROGRAMA DEL CURSO: JSP
Objetivos: Introducir al alumno en la creación de Webs dinámicas. Gestión de bases de datos a través de internet mediante el diseño de páginas webs.
Requisitos: Conocimientos de Windows y de diseño de páginas webs (HTML). Recomendable algunos conocimientos de programación.
Horarios: En CEPI-BASE el alumno elige el día de inicio y la hora de asistencia a clase, pudiendo modificarlos a su conveniencia.
Metodología: Enseñanza personalizada, profesor alumno. Clases prácticas desde el primer día
Duración: El curso tiene una duración aproximada de 90 horas.
Estas horas son estimadas a modo de referencia, no todos los alumnos necesitan las mismas horas, todo depende de la capacidad de cada uno en asimilar el temario. Nuestros cursos no van por horas, se rigen por el temario del curso.
En CEPI-BASE los cursos finalizan cuando el alumno ha terminado el temario.
TEMARIO DEL CURSO: JSP
INTRODUCCIÓN
– LENGUAJES DE PROGRAMar DE CGI=S
– PROGRAMAS DEL CURSO
– CONVENCIONES USADAS EN ESTE DOSSIER
* Términos empleados para el ratón
CONFIGURACIÓN DEL ENTORNO
– JDK
– TOMCAT
– CONFIGURACIÓN DEL ENTORNO
* Inicio de Tomcat
* Configurar sitio web
* Detener Tomcat /Editor TextPad
– COMPOSICIÓN DE UNA PÁGINA JSP
* Comentarios /Declaraciones
* Expresiones
* Scriptlets de código
– PROVEEDORES EN INTERNET
INTRODUCCIÓN AL CÓDIGO JSP
– TIPOS DE DATOS
* Constantes/Variables
* Nomenclatura y declaración de constantes y variables
* Valores iniciales
* Ejercicios
– OPERADORES
* Operadores aritméticos/ de asignación
* Operadores relacionales o de comparación
* Operadores lógicos
* Ejercicios
– FUNCIONES
* Envío y recepción de parámetros
– ALCANCE DE LAS VARIABLES
* Variables globales / Variables locales
– TOMA DE DECISIONES
* Instrucción if /Instrucción switch
– BUCLES
* Bucle for / Bucle while /Bucle do .. while
* Break y continue
– MATRICES
* Cadenas de caracteres
– EJERCICIOS
PROGRAMACIÓN ORIENTADA A OBJETOS
– QUÉ ES UN OBJETO?
– ENCAPSULACIÓN
* Constructores
* Protección de los miembros del objeto
* Compilar la clase
* Utilizar una clase
– HERENCIA
* Tipo base original
– MÉTODO DE SOBRECARGA
– CLASE ABSTRACTA
– INTERFACES
– EJERCICIOS
* Calculadora
* Conversiones
OBTENCIÓN DE DATOS DEL NAVEGADOR
– OBJETO REQUEST
– FORMULARIOS
* Formulario HTML y página JSP
* Formulario con 2 páginas JSP
* Formulario de dos páginas JSP y un bean
– CONTROLES
* Listas desplegables
* Casillas de verificación
* Botones de radio
* TextArea
– EJERCICIOS
* Formulario de factura
* Mi Ordenador
BIBLIOTECAS DE ETIQUETAS
– ETIQUETAS BEAN
* Etiqueta
* Etiqueta
* Etiqueta
– ETIQUETAS DE ACCIONES
* Etiqueta
* Etiqueta
* Etiqueta
– DIRECTIVAS
* Directiva page /Directiva include
* Directiva taglib
– ETIQUETAS PERSONALIZADAS
* Construir una etiqueta
* Interfaz TAG
* Interfaz Iteration Tag
* Interfaz BodyTag
* Atributos de las etiquetas
– EJERCICIOS
* Idiomas
* Uso de etiquetas
CLASES DE UTILIDADES
– COLECCIONES
* Conjuntos
* Listas
* Mapas
– CLASES DE TIPOS DE DATOS
* Clase Date
* Clase SimpleDateFormat
* Clase Math
– clases de tipo de datos primitivos
* Integer / Long
* Flota
* Double
– EJERCICIOS
* Comprobación cumpleaños
DEPURACIÓN DE ERRORES
– excepciones
* try.. catch
* Clausula finally
* Lanzar excepciones
– páginas de error
* Crear una página de error
* Utilizar una página de erro
– ejercicios
* Control MiniCalculadora
CONTROL DE USUARIOS
– peronalizar las páginas de los usuarios
– objeto cookie
* Ejemplo:color de Fondo
* Ejemplo:personalización de la página
– objetos session
* Ejemplo: Frutería
– objeto application
* Ejemplo: Contador
* Ejemplo: Foro de opiniones
– ejercicios
* Chat
ARCHIVOS
– acceso a archivos
– archivos de texto
* Control de excepciones
– archivos estructurados
– ejercicios
* Acceso a un edificio
BASES DE DATOS
– JDBC(JAVA DATABASE CONECTIVITY)
– ODBC (OPEN DATABASE CONNECTIVITY)
– CLASES DEL JDBC
* Práctica Bases de datos
* Crear la tabla
* Añadir registros a la tabla
* Eliminar registros
* Consultar registros
* Modificar registros
– conectar una base de datos sin dsn
– ejercicios
* DVD’s
CORREO ELECTRÓNICO
– javamail
* Clase session
* Clase message
* Clase address
* Clase transport
– enviar un mensaje de texto (ejemplo práctico)
– enviar un mensaje html(ejemplo práctico)
– adjuntar archivos a mensajes
– recibir mensajes
recibir mensajes con adjuntos
En CEPI-BASE los cursos finalizan cuando el alumno ha terminado el temario.